GOODWORTH CLATFORD VILLAGE CLUB CIO  CHARITY NUMBER 1190564 

## TRUSTEES ANNUAL REPORT 

The Trustees of the Village Club have settled into the first full year of their new status as a CIO charity, and have been active in fulfilling the objects of the charity. This has been achieved by maintaining the Club and its grounds in good working order and using the Club for a wide range of events for the village and the surrounding area. The Club is available for private hire and after a rather quiet period during the Covid period, bookings are approaching the pre-pandemic level. Thanks to generous grants from Test Valley Council the finances are in a good state. Trustees are mindful always of the need to demonstrate public benefit which they do by running a range of activities from the village fete to village quiz nights, both open to all-comers. The two tenants lodged on Club land also contribute to the public good - the Scouts by running an active pack, and the tennis club by using the charity’s courts for village players of all ages and standards. 

The coming year will see a continued emphasis on public benefit  not least with the second of the annual art fairs.
